CCHS' defense dominant in 13-0 jamboree victory

Central Catholic’s defense dominated Centerville in a 13-0 victory Friday at the Taco Bell Jamboree. The Eagles limited Centerville to 7 yards of offense (minus 6 rushing and 13 yards passing). The Bulldogs only recorded one first down, which came on its final drive of the night. Meanwhile the Eagles recorded 219 yards of offense, including 216 yards rushing. Hugh Hamer led the squad with seven carries for 113 yards and two touchdowns, while Davidyione Bias had nine carries for 90 yards.
